Output 81c4101b952448fb38325fb89f5c8585c24db7397bfe6335463d51189993f8fc:0

value
147603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8a80934ca6845008e60fb3753b97bfd8573491 OP_EQUAL
address
3MyhrSBXFGDUmAJYHc521ciNHw2nSYPGkC
transaction
81c4101b952448fb38325fb89f5c8585c24db7397bfe6335463d51189993f8fc
confirmations
333996
spent
true